How to fill out release and verification

How to fill out release and verification:
01
Start by carefully reading the release and verification form provided. Understand the purpose and scope of the form before proceeding.
02
Begin with your personal information section. Fill in your full name, address, contact details, and any other information required. Double-check for accuracy and make any necessary corrections.
03
If the form requires you to provide identification details, such as a driver's license number or social security number, ensure that you enter the information accurately.
04
Move on to the release section. Read the release statement thoroughly and make sure you understand its implications. By signing the release, you are granting permission to a particular individual or organization to access or disclose certain information or perform specific actions.
05
If there are any specific limitations or conditions mentioned in the release statement, make sure you adhere to them while filling out the form.
06
Sign and date the release section after carefully reading and understanding its contents. This indicates your consent to the release terms.
07
In the verification section, you might be required to provide additional supporting documents or proof of identity, depending on the purpose of the form. Attach copies of the required documents as instructed.
08
Review the completed form for any errors or missing information. Take the time to ensure that all sections are filled out accurately and completely.
09
If you have any doubts or questions, seek clarification from the appropriate authority or contact the relevant personnel responsible for processing the form.
10
Finally, submit the completed release and verification form as instructed, either by mail, fax, or in person.
Who needs release and verification:
01
Individuals applying for jobs that require background checks or clearance often need to fill out release and verification forms. This allows the potential employer to verify the applicant's information and conduct a thorough background check.
02
Educational institutions may require release and verification forms when transferring student records between schools or for admitting students with previous educational background or disciplinary issues.
03
Healthcare providers often require release and verification forms to access a patient's medical records or share patient information with other healthcare professionals involved in the individual's care.
04
Organizations conducting research studies or surveys may need participants to sign release and verification forms, allowing them to use the data for analysis and publication while ensuring the confidentiality and privacy of the participants.
05
In some legal matters, attorneys may request individuals to sign release and verification forms to obtain necessary documents, records, or information from relevant parties involved in the case.
06
Financial institutions may require customers to fill out release and verification forms to process certain transactions, such as releasing tax information to file returns or conducting credit checks for loan applications.
